What is the purpose of lash enhancers?

What is the purpose of lash enhancers?
Eyelashes decrease in length by almost 50% from our 20’s to our 40’s. Millions are being spent every year in false lashes, mascara, and eyeliner to cosmetically improve eyelashes. Lash enhancers are now available to provide similar or even better results ‘naturally’. Latisse has been FDA approved to lengthen (25%), thicken (106%) and darken (18%) eyelashes- counteract the natural decrease in length, thickness and darkness that occurs in our eyelashes as we age. Off label, Latisse will thicken eyebrows as well.

What is the difference between lash growth enhancers available over-the-counter and those that require a prescription?
Latisse is THE ONLY FDA approved product to lengthen eyelashes.  ALL others have not been approved so we don’t know what is in them and/or they are simply eyelash conditioners, which may help improve eyelashes, but cannot make a claim to enhance their growth.

Who is the ideal candidate for lash growth enhancers, and who should not use them?
An ideal candidate is anyone who is concerned about their eyelashes. Whether the candidate has thin, weak, or short eyelashes, Latisse will improve the condition. Even someone who uses false eyelashes will find Latisse to strengthen their lashes for a better, longer-lasting hold. It is important to always consult a licensed practitioner since Latisse is only obtained through a doctor’s prescription.

How are lash enhancers applied?
Topically to the base of the lashes. Although it is recommended to use every night prior to sleeping, it can be used each morning if preferred.

Why is it important to use a lash growth enhancer?
To achieve longer, thicker and darker eyelashes, which enhance and frame the eyes. Longer, thicker, and darker lashes are associated with youth and beauty.

What should consumers look for when choosing an enhancer?
FDA approved= safety and efficacy, licensed clinical recommendation and proven results.

Trending Medical Procedures: Dr. Gabriel Chiu, Beverly Hills Plastic Surgery, Inc.

What would you say is the most popular medical or cosmetic procedure being requested at your office right now?

Liposuction. Some of the most popular areas right now are stomach and love handles, arms, and thighs as everyone is getting ready for spring break and summer beach bodies. High definition facial liposuction to the jawline is also popular to provide a more “sharp” and youthful look.

What does this procedure entail, and what issues does it address?

Liposuction can address any problem areas. It involves using a long, hollow rod with holes on one end and a vacuum on the other to shear and suction fat cells after the tissues have been treated with a medicated solution. I am known for high-definition liposuction, during which stylized and customized cannulas are used to targeted areas for a high-intensity, sculpted look.

Why do you think this has become a trend?

Liposuction is especially popular right now as people are getting ready for spring weddings and the summer. While the stomach and love handles have been and always will be popular, arms and jawlines have been extremely popular with brides and bridesmaids so that they can look their best in strapless gowns and for their photos- which every bride uses to reminisce throughout their lifetime. Thighs are often requested in preparation for summer because of all the short shorts, daisy dukes, miniskirts, and bikinis.

To whom would you recommend this procedure? Who would be the ideal candidate?

The ideal candidate will be healthy, in relatively good shape, but with problem areas that never seem to go away no matter how hard they work out, how diligently they diet, or what treatments they succumb their bodies to. Ideal candidates will not have significant stretch marks, sagging tissues, or poor skin tone.

Choosing a Plastic Surgeon: Things to Remember

Some of the factors often overlooked when choosing a plastic surgeon are, in fact, essential elements to take into consideration. The following tips are intended to help you make an educated decision:

1) Do Your Research

Review doctors online, before and after photos, patient testimonials, and credentials, to narrow down the top 3 doctors (or less). In reviewing photos, it is best when sets of photos have descriptions of what procedure was performed, when the post-op photo was taken, and any other details on the patient or the procedure. Also make sure that not only are there plenty of photos, but each set of photos are shot at the same angle, with the same lighting, and same patient positioning. In reviewing credentials, make sure to see that the surgeon is indeed a plastic surgeon (not cosmetic surgeon). Plastic surgeons have completed a fellowship in Plastic and Reconstructive Surgery, taking a minimum of two years to do so.

2) Procedure Consistency

When comparing your options, make sure you are evaluating for the same procedures; surgeons may recommend different surgeries for the same problem. Will the scars be the same for the breast lift? Is the liposuction covering the exact same areas? If there are differences, what will be the difference in results?

3) Consider Additional Costs

Same goes for pricing- make sure you are comparing like for like. If it sounds too good to be true when compared to other prices, it probably is, since the lowest price may not be the best deal. Does surgery include operating room and anesthesia costs? Will you have to pay for garments, labs, and medications? If so, what will you be getting? How much will they cost?

4) Consult With Previous Patients

Ask to speak with other patients. Make sure they have gone through the same procedures. Do they have any tips for you? Would they have done anything differently? Were they forgotten after surgery was done?

5) Plan Aftercare and Recovery

As plastic surgery is considered major surgery, it is important to make sure that you follow your surgeon’s strict guidelines for proper post-surgical recovery. For instance, for older patients or those with particular health history, a plastic surgeon may recommend a fully-equipped aftercare facility with 24 hour nursing care. Other common instructions include not boarding an airplane for long flights, or avoiding physical activities.

6) Consider The Surgical Experience

Compare the experience- will you be charged for post-op visits? How about a month or two after surgery? Is the doctor the one who sees you, or someone else (who you may not have even met before your surgery)? How accessible is your surgeon, especially after surgery? Will you be calling your doctor, a staff member, or an answering service after hours?

7) Feel Comfortable

Make sure you are comfortable with the doctor, the staff, and anyone else you may come in contact with throughout your experience. They will all contribute to your experience- and you want to have a good one.

8) Trust Your Gut

After you have evaluated all these things, go with your gut instincts. It has to feel right for you to move forward!
